Tiffanee Arnold, MFA

Tiffanee Arnold is currently the Chair of the Dance Department and Professor of Dance. As Chair of the Dance Department, Tiffanee is responsible for all aspects of the department including curriculum development, student advising, budgeting, recruitment, marketing, website development, strategic planning, course scheduling, college task forces and managing and hiring of all part-time faculty.

Tiffanee has grown the dance program dramatically in her years at Collin College. When she began teaching in 1998, the dance department offered just nine courses, all held in one dance studio, with an enrollment of only 122 students. Currently, students may choose among twenty-three dance courses offered on three campuses in four dance studios. Student enrollment in dance has grown steadily each year with over 800 student enrollments in Spring 2010. Her initiative at Collin College won Tiffanee the 1998 Promising Professional Kitty McGee Alumni Award from Texas Woman's University (where she earned her MFA in Dance Performance and Choreography).

Under the direction of Tiffanee Arnold, Collin College's Dance Program has gained the reputation for excellence in dance education, choreography and performance. Tiffanee has created opportunities for educational enrichment through dance seminars, workshops, summer dance festivals and camps, choreography showcases, and guest artist residencies with international companies such as: Jhon R. Stronks (Los Angeles), Pilobolus Too (Pilobolus Dance Theatre), Battleworks Dance Company (New York), Taylor 2 (Paul Taylor Dance Company), Janice Garrett & Dancers (San Francisco), Eisenhower Dance Ensemble (Michigan), Cheryl Chaddick Dance Theatre (Austin), Houston Metropolitan Dance Company (Houston) and Elledanceworks Dance Company (Dallas).

The success of the Collin Dance Ensemble (CDE), the repertory student dance company, has garnered not only regional but national attention. As Artistic Director, Tiffanee choreographs, advises student choreography and serves as production manager. CDE provides unparalleled opportunities for community-college students to perform and to create their own pieces. CDE maintains a strong presence in the DFW dance community with performances at area high schools, festivals and college-wide events. Every spring, the company performs at the American College Dance Regional Festivals. There, among four-year colleges and graduate programs, these two-year community college dancers have been honored six times by selection for the Gala performances. Specifically, Tiffanee's choreography Stood Up and Over It, Dunes, Prisoners, and Momentum have been honored by selection for the Gala. In June 2008 the American College National Dance Festival invited CDE to perform in New York.

In 2005, Tiffanee received the Outstanding Professor Award in the Fine Arts Division at Collin College. Her undergraduate institution, Western Illinois University, awarded her its Distinguished Dance Alumni Award in 2007. She has also received numerous "Faculty Recognized Scholarships" on behalf of the Collin College President to honor her service to the college by giving financial assistance to college dance students.

In addition to teaching at Collin College, Tiffanee continues to teach master classes at the American College Regional Dance Festivals and has been commissioned for dance residencies at Western Illinois University, Stephen F. Austin State University, Texas Woman's University, Newman Smith High School and Booker T. Washington High School for the Visual and Performing Arts.

Tiffanee is currently in her eleventh season as a member with a Dallas-based professional dance company, Elledanceworks Dance Company.
